About Melisa Edwards
Sustainability, Zero Waste, Plastic Free OceansI am a leader and influencer creating the solution for a sustainable future and zero waste through education, community engagement, program and project management, and innovative research all focused on this defining problem of our time.As an environmental scientist, I declared war on waste in my personal life, and my goal is to influence as many people and organizations as possible to do the same. Much of my graduate work at Johns Hopkins University was focusing on this very issue; how to convert waste to resources while creating a sustainable economy. My passion is focused on plastic and food waste that has become an ever-growing problem for both the environment and society. We need to reduce the use of single-use plastics and to use non-recyclable waste as a secondary product such as conversion to fuel via waste-to-fuel technologies, use of plastics as building material for roads and homes, or finding some other innovative method to reuse and repurpose plastics. Food waste reduction through better policy and distribution can help feed those less fortunate and other food waste can be repurposed through composting for the growth of sustainable crops. I believe that oceans should be protected since they are the essence of planet Earth and humankind, producing more than half of all oxygen in the atmosphere and absorbing the most carbon from it. After living in Hawaii for almost five years and conducting research or visits to the Galapagos Islands, Bahamas, Iceland, the Adriatic Coast, and both coasts of the United States my determination is even stronger to try and protect oceans and their beauty by working on plastic-free oceans.
